What You’ll Do

  • Supervise the implementation and maintenance of financial management practices.
  • Oversee financial administration processes, including salaries, tax payments, and bookkeeping.
  • Maintain and verify claims recoverable and payable accounts for provincial and national departments.
  • Monitor and verify cheque payments and manage outstanding claims.
  • Provide first-line support to users of the BAS system and assist with user training.
  • Compile reports and manage financial records, ensuring compliance with relevant policies and regulations.

What You’ll Need

  • Senior Certificate along with a Diploma in Financial Management at NQF 6 or equivalent recognized by SAQA.
  • A minimum of 3 years’ experience in a finance environment.
  • LOGIS/BAS certification.
  • Proficient knowledge of LOGIS/BAS and PERSAL systems.
  • Strong problem-solving, analytical, and supervisory skills.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
